
在Excel中防止图片随意移动的方法包括:锁定图片、调整图片属性、使用图层管理。锁定图片是防止图片在工作表中移动的最直接方法。下面将详细描述如何锁定图片。
锁定图片是通过将图片与单元格绑定来实现的。这意味着当您调整单元格的大小或排序数据时,图片将保持在其相应的单元格内。要锁定图片,请首先右键单击图片,然后选择“大小和属性”。在弹出的对话框中,选择“属性”选项卡,并选中“随单元格移动和调整大小”选项。这样,图片就会随单元格的改变而调整,而不会单独移动。
一、锁定图片
锁定图片是确保图片在Excel工作表中不随意移动的最基本方法。通过将图片与单元格绑定,可以确保图片在调整单元格大小或排序数据时保持在相应的位置。
1.1 右键单击图片
首先,打开Excel工作表并插入图片。然后,右键单击需要锁定的图片。在右键菜单中,选择“大小和属性”选项。这将打开一个对话框,其中包含与图片相关的多个设置选项。
1.2 设置图片属性
在“大小和属性”对话框中,选择“属性”选项卡。然后,找到并选中“随单元格移动和调整大小”选项。这个选项确保图片在单元格调整大小时跟随单元格一起移动和调整大小。完成后,单击“关闭”按钮以保存更改。
1.3 验证图片锁定
为了确保图片已成功锁定,您可以尝试调整单元格的大小或排序数据。锁定的图片应该保持在其相应的单元格内,不会单独移动或改变位置。如果图片仍然移动,请重新检查设置,确保已正确选中“随单元格移动和调整大小”选项。
二、调整图片属性
除了锁定图片外,调整图片的属性也可以防止图片在Excel工作表中随意移动。通过调整图片的属性,可以更好地控制图片的行为和显示方式。
2.1 调整图片大小
在插入图片后,可以手动调整图片的大小以适应单元格的大小。通过拖动图片的边缘或角点,可以调整图片的尺寸,使其与单元格的大小相匹配。这样,即使单元格大小发生变化,图片也可以保持在预期的位置。
2.2 设置图片格式
在图片上右键单击,然后选择“设置图片格式”选项。在弹出的对话框中,可以调整图片的颜色、透明度、边框等属性。通过设置图片的格式,可以更好地控制图片的显示效果,从而避免图片在工作表中随意移动。
三、使用图层管理
Excel提供了一种图层管理功能,可以帮助用户更好地管理工作表中的图片和其他对象。通过使用图层管理,可以确保图片在工作表中保持在预期的位置。
3.1 打开选择窗格
要使用图层管理功能,首先需要打开选择窗格。在Excel菜单中,选择“格式”选项卡,然后在“排列”组中单击“选择窗格”按钮。这将打开一个选择窗格,其中列出了当前工作表中的所有对象,包括图片。
3.2 管理图层顺序
在选择窗格中,可以通过拖动对象来调整图层顺序。将图片放置在适当的位置,以确保它们不会被其他对象覆盖或随意移动。通过调整图层顺序,可以更好地控制图片在工作表中的显示效果。
3.3 隐藏或锁定对象
选择窗格还允许用户隐藏或锁定对象。通过单击对象旁边的眼睛图标,可以隐藏该对象,使其在工作表中不可见。通过单击对象旁边的锁定图标,可以锁定该对象,防止其被意外移动或修改。使用这些功能,可以更好地管理工作表中的图片和其他对象。
四、使用单元格内的图片
在某些情况下,将图片插入单元格内可以提供更好的控制和稳定性。通过将图片嵌入单元格,可以确保图片在工作表中保持在固定位置。
4.1 插入图片到单元格
首先,选择要插入图片的单元格。然后,在Excel菜单中选择“插入”选项卡,并单击“图片”按钮。在弹出的对话框中,选择要插入的图片文件。插入图片后,可以通过调整单元格的大小来适应图片的尺寸。
4.2 调整单元格大小
为了确保图片在单元格内保持固定位置,可以手动调整单元格的大小。通过拖动单元格边缘,可以调整单元格的高度和宽度,使其与图片的尺寸相匹配。这样,即使工作表发生变化,图片也可以保持在单元格内。
4.3 使用单元格格式
可以通过调整单元格的格式来增强图片的显示效果。右键单击包含图片的单元格,然后选择“设置单元格格式”选项。在弹出的对话框中,可以调整单元格的对齐方式、边框、填充等属性。通过设置单元格格式,可以更好地控制图片在单元格内的显示效果。
五、使用图片控件
Excel还提供了图片控件功能,可以帮助用户更好地管理工作表中的图片。通过使用图片控件,可以将图片绑定到特定的单元格,并控制其显示和行为。
5.1 插入图片控件
首先,在Excel菜单中选择“开发工具”选项卡。如果“开发工具”选项卡未显示,可以通过选择“文件”>“选项”>“自定义功能区”来启用。在“开发工具”选项卡中,单击“插入”按钮,然后选择“图片控件”选项。在工作表中单击以插入图片控件。
5.2 绑定图片控件到单元格
插入图片控件后,可以将其绑定到特定的单元格。右键单击图片控件,然后选择“属性”选项。在弹出的对话框中,找到“LinkedCell”属性,并输入要绑定的单元格引用。例如,如果要将图片控件绑定到A1单元格,可以输入“A1”。完成后,单击“确定”按钮以保存更改。
5.3 管理图片控件
通过图片控件,可以更好地管理工作表中的图片。可以调整图片控件的大小和位置,使其与单元格对齐。此外,还可以使用图片控件的属性来控制图片的显示和行为。例如,可以设置图片的透明度、边框等属性,以满足特定需求。
六、使用模板
使用模板是确保图片在Excel工作表中保持稳定位置的另一种方法。通过创建包含图片的模板,可以避免在每次使用图片时重新调整和锁定图片。
6.1 创建模板
首先,创建一个包含图片的Excel工作表。将图片插入到工作表中,并调整其位置和大小。然后,在Excel菜单中选择“文件”>“另存为”选项。在弹出的对话框中,选择“Excel模板”文件类型,并为模板命名。单击“保存”按钮以创建模板。
6.2 使用模板
要使用创建的模板,可以在Excel菜单中选择“文件”>“新建”选项。在弹出的对话框中,选择“个人”选项卡,然后选择创建的模板。这样,新的工作表将基于模板创建,并包含预先设置好的图片位置和属性。
6.3 管理模板
通过管理模板,可以更好地控制图片在工作表中的显示效果。可以根据需要更新模板,例如调整图片位置、大小和属性。通过使用模板,可以确保每次使用图片时都保持一致的显示效果。
七、使用代码实现
对于高级用户,可以使用VBA(Visual Basic for Applications)代码来实现图片的锁定和管理。通过编写代码,可以更精确地控制图片的行为和显示效果。
7.1 启用开发工具
首先,需要启用开发工具选项卡。在Excel菜单中选择“文件”>“选项”>“自定义功能区”,并勾选“开发工具”选项。完成后,单击“确定”按钮以保存更改。
7.2 编写VBA代码
在开发工具选项卡中,单击“Visual Basic”按钮以打开VBA编辑器。在VBA编辑器中,选择要编写代码的工作表。在代码窗口中,可以编写VBA代码来实现图片的锁定和管理。例如,可以使用以下代码将图片锁定到特定单元格:
Sub LockPicture()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im pic As Shape
Set pic = ws.Shapes("Picture 1")
With pic
.LockAspectRatio = msoTrue
.Placement = xlMoveAndSize
End With
End Sub
7.3 运行VBA代码
编写完成后,可以通过单击“运行”按钮来执行VBA代码。代码将按照设置将图片锁定到特定单元格,并控制其显示和行为。通过使用VBA代码,可以更灵活地管理工作表中的图片。
八、总结
在Excel中防止图片随意移动的方法包括锁定图片、调整图片属性、使用图层管理、将图片嵌入单元格、使用图片控件、使用模板以及使用VBA代码。这些方法可以帮助用户更好地控制图片在工作表中的行为和显示效果,从而提高工作效率和工作表的美观度。根据实际需求选择适合的方法,并结合以上技巧,可以确保图片在Excel工作表中保持稳定位置。
相关问答FAQs:
1. 如何固定Excel中的图片,使其不会随意移动?
- 在Excel中,您可以通过以下步骤来固定图片,使其不会随意移动:
- 选中要固定的图片。
- 在“格式”选项卡上,找到“位置”组。
- 点击“位置”组中的“属性”。
- 在弹出的对话框中,选择“固定位置”选项。
- 点击“确定”以应用更改。
2. 如何防止Excel中的图片在单元格中移动?
- 如果您希望Excel中的图片始终保持在特定的单元格中,可以按照以下步骤进行操作:
- 选中要固定的图片。
- 在“格式”选项卡上,找到“位置”组。
- 点击“位置”组中的“属性”。
- 在弹出的对话框中,选择“移动和调整大小时,与单元格一起移动和调整大小”选项。
- 点击“确定”以应用更改。
3. 如何在Excel中锁定图片的位置,以防止其随意移动?
- 要在Excel中锁定图片的位置,您可以按照以下步骤进行操作:
- 选中要锁定的图片。
- 在右键菜单中,选择“格式图片”选项。
- 在弹出的对话框中,选择“属性”选项卡。
- 勾选“锁定位置”复选框。
- 点击“确定”以应用更改。
- 这样,图片就会被锁定在当前位置,不会随意移动。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4458047